Visitors who feel unwell should be escorted to the first-aid room on the ground floor of Quellwood House, next to the east stairwell. Reception staff must remain with the visitor until a trained first-aider from the Hallam Group duty rota arrives. Do not leave visitors unattended in the room, and log each use in the welfare book. The door locks automatically; if the duty first-aider is delayed, reception may open it using the code below.

staff pass of kawip-hawef = bdg-QLP-2

## Escalation: BranchSweep Bot

If BranchSweep deletes a branch that still has an open review, do not recreate it manually. Restore it from the reflog mirror on the Hargrove archive node, then add the branch name to the `sweep-exempt` list in the bot's config repo. BranchSweep runs hourly, so apply the exemption before the next cycle. If the bot keeps flagging exempted branches, that indicates a config sync failure and needs a human. In that case, escalate directly to the tooling maintainer.

billing contact of kagaf-bahif = fraox_ralvan_tamwyn@zemvarcloud.local

### Action Item: Spoolhaven Retry Storm

From last Tuesday's outage: the Spoolhaven print service retried failed jobs without backoff, saturating the render pool. Fix merged; retries now use capped exponential backoff with jitter. Owner will monitor for a week before closing. The agreed retry constants are recorded below.

constants for yadup-kajof:
RATE_LIMITS = {
    "zorwyn": 1,
    "druwyn": 1,
}

**Q: Hugediff won't open a 4 GB artifact after the release branch cut. What now?**

A: Hugediff streams chunks from the Ferrowane cache; if the cache node restarted, the index is stale. Restart the viewer with cold-load mode. If it still fails, the release manager must unseal the fallback archive node. Unsealing prompts once and only once — no retries. Have the value ready before you start. The archive node accepts the recovery passphrase shown on the next line.

recovery phrase for yawig-kajog: casox-prair-holax-quenix-fraael-belath-casath